Illinois Median Pay
$46,010
$22.12 per hour
U.S. Median Pay
$45,230
$21.75 per hour
What to Compare (Quick Checklist) NAACLS or equivalent accreditation status NHA CPT or ASCP PBT certification prep and pass rates Clinical hours and minimum venipuncture sticks required State certification or licensing requirements Specimen processing and lab safety training Next Steps Use ZIP search to widen your radius, then verify program details directly with each school.
